https://m.post.naver.com/viewer/postView.nhn?volumeNo=7964070&memberNo=34318784&vType=VERTICAL
손칼국수 집 맛이 어떠할지 기대된다.+.+
https://m.post.naver.com/viewer/postView.nhn?volumeNo=7964070&memberNo=34318784&vType=VERTICAL
손칼국수 집 맛이 어떠할지 기대된다.+.+
네이버 지식백과에서 잘 정리된 자전거 관리 TIP 발견~
(Part5.반짝반짝 널 닦아줄거야 참고. 그 외 자전거 관련 글들 다수)
출처: http://terms.naver.com/entry.nhn?categoryId=714&docId=1006550&cid=714
오라클(oracle) 락(lock) 확인 및 제거(kill)
======================================================================================
-- 락걸린 테이블 확인
SELECT do.object_name, do.owner, do.object_type, do.owner,
vo.xidusn, vo.session_id, vo.locked_mode
FROM
v$locked_object vo , dba_objects do
WHERE vo.object_id = do.object_id ;
--해당테이블이 락에 걸렸는지..
SELECT A.SID, A.SERIAL#, B.TYPE, C.OBJECT_NAME
FROM V$SESSION A, V$LOCK B, DBA_OBJECTS C
WHERE A.SID=B.SID AND B.ID1=C.OBJECT_ID
AND B.TYPE='TM' AND C.OBJECT_NAME IN ('테이블명');
/* 락발생 사용자와 sql, object 조회 */
SELECT distinct x.session_id, a.serial#,
d.object_name, a.machine, a.terminal,
a.program, b.address, b.piece, b.sql_text
FROM v$locked_object x, v$session a, v$sqltext b, dba_objects d
WHERE x.session_id = a.sid and
x.object_id = d.object_id and
a.sql_address = b.address
order by b.address,b.piece;
/* 락 발생 사용자확인 */
SELECT distinct x.session_id, a.serial#,
d.object_name, a.machine, a.terminal, a.program,
a.logon_time , 'alter system kill session ''' || a.sid || ', ' || a.serial# || ''';'
FROM gv$locked_object x, gv$session a, dba_objects d
WHERE x.session_id = a.sid and x.object_id = d.object_id
order by logon_time;
/* 접속 사용자 제거 */
--alter system kill session 'session_id,serial#';
alter system kill session '26,6044';
/* 현재 접속자의 sql 분석 */
SELECT distinct a.sid, a.serial#,
a.machine, a.terminal, a.program,
b.address, b.piece, b.sql_text
FROM v$session a, v$sqltext b
WHERE a.sql_address = b.address
order by a.sid, a.serial#,b.address,b.piece;
오라클 로컬 접속 (0) | 2013.05.25 |
---|---|
오라클 기본 사용자 (0) | 2013.03.21 |
오랜만에 토드로 오라클 로컬에 접속하려고 했는데 안되었다.
한참을 뒤적거리다가 찾은 문제는 바로...오라클 서비스 실행을 안했던 것;;
오라클 서비스를 실행하면 노트북 속도가 느려져서 꺼두었었는데 오랜만에 해보려니 까맣게 잊은 것이다.
역시 자주 보지않으면 별 것 아닌 것도 이렇게 헤매게 된다.ㅎㅎ
아래 오라클 접속 기초에 도움이 될 만한 자료를 링크해둔다.
락(lock) 확인 및 제거(kill) (0) | 2013.08.09 |
---|---|
오라클 기본 사용자 (0) | 2013.03.21 |
1. sys : 오라클 수퍼사용자로 데이터베이스에서 발생하는 모든 문제를 처리할 수 있는 권한을 가짐
2. system :오라클 데이터베이스를 유지보수 관리할 때 사용하는 ID이며, sys 사용자와 차이점은
데이터베이스를 생성할 수 있는 권한이 없다.
3. scott : 처음 오라클 데이터베이스를 사용하는 사람을 위하여 만들어 놓은 sample 사용자 ID이다.
4. hr : sample 사용자 ID이다.
cf) INTERNAL은 사용자는 아니지만, internal로 접속하면 SYS 계정을 사용 할 뿐이다. 그런데, 8i의 경우 connect
internal은 커맨드창에서 svrmgrl을 실행한 뒤에 connect internal하면 되었다. 그러나 SQL> 프롬프트 상에서는 안 된
다.
그리고 9i부터는 internal이 없어졌다. 그래서 9i의 경우에는
# sqlplus /nolog
SQL> connect / as sysdba
로 접속하면 internal과 같은 sys 권한으로 접속하게 된다.
출처 : http://radiocom.kunsan.ac.kr/lecture/oracle/what_is/diff_sys_system.html
락(lock) 확인 및 제거(kill) (0) | 2013.08.09 |
---|---|
오라클 로컬 접속 (0) | 2013.05.25 |
'지금 이 순간을 잡아라. 그대가 할 수 있는 일, 꿀 수 있는 꿈을, 마음을 넓게 크게 먹고 시작하라.
담대함에는 재능과 힘과 마법이 있다.'
- 요한 볼프강 폰 괴테 -
우연히 이 글을 보고 순간 또 깨닫게 된다. 좋은 글은 언제나 사람을 깨우는 힘을 가지고 있는 것 같다.
매일을 새롭게, 감사하게, 담대하게
책으로 ASP.NET 2.0 예제 학습 중 책과 분명 같은 코딩을 했는데 이런 오류가 나면서 빌드가 안되어 몇 일간 해매다
다음의 글(http://blog.naver.com/anytimel/70018110335)을 보고 해결할 수 있었다. 나 역시 web.config 파일이 엉뚱
한 곳에 중복해서 들어가있던게 원인이었던 것 같다. 깔끔하게 빌드가 되었을 때의 느낌이란!
- 기록없이 간단히 쿼리창 연결 : c:\sqlplus /nolog
- 서버에서 리스너 컨트롤 : c:\lsnrctl
(이후 LSNRCTL>에서 help를 입력하면 다양한 컨트롤 정보 볼 수 있다. ex) start 리스너 시작, stop 리스너 종료,
한 번에 c:\lsnrctl start 로 명령을 줄 수도 있다.)
ps. 추후 지속적 업데이트 예정
tnsnames.ora 파일에 대한 설명(펌) http://true050.blog.me/130025428129
[정수 데이터 형식]
형식 | 범위 | 크기 |
sbyte |
-128 ~ 127 | 부호 O, 8비트 정수 |
byte |
0 ~ 255 |
부호 X, 8비트 정수 |
char |
U+0000 ~ U+ffff |
유니코드 16비트 문자 |
short |
-32,768 ~ 32,767 |
부호 O, 16비트 정수 |
ushort |
0 ~ 65,535 |
부호 X, 16비트 정수 |
int |
-2,147,483,648 ~ 2,147,483,647 |
부호 O, 32비트 정수 |
uint |
0 ~ 4,294,967,295 |
부호 X, 32비트 정수 |
long |
-9,223,372,036,854,775,808 ~ 9,223,372,036,854,775,807 |
부호 O, 64비트 정수 |
ulong |
0 ~ 18,446,744,073,709,551,615 |
부호 X, 64비트 정수 |
ulong의 경우는 무려 천팔백사십사경육천칠백사십사조칠백삼십칠억구백오십만천육백십오까지 표현할 수 있다.ㅎ